Heavy rain and strong winds forecast for weekend
New York is preparing for a weekend of severe weather, with forecasts predicting heavy rain and strong winds across the region. The National Weather Service anticipates that the weather system will move in from the west, bringing significant rainfall, potentially reaching up to 2 inches in some areas. This could lead to localized flooding, particularly in low-lying areas and those with inadequate drainage systems. Accompanying the rain will be strong winds, with gusts expected to reach up to 40 mph. Coastal regions and higher elevations are especially vulnerable to these high winds, which could pose a risk to trees and power lines, increasing the likelihood of power outages.
